An elegant early French
Louis XIV seconds pendulum 8-day quarter and hour striking longcase clock,
the movement and dial signed Saint Martin à Paris, ebony and ebonised
pearwood veneered on oak, ormolu mounted, tortoiseshell and brass inlay,
235 cm high, ca. 1700. |
